Edit customer details
Every field is inline-editable, every change writes to the audit log.
Open any customer and click a field to edit it. Changes save on blur or ⌘+Enter, and each write becomes an entry in the activity feed with the old value, the new value, and who made the change. CRM-synced fields show a small sync icon and a tooltip naming the source.

Bulk edits
When you want to update plan, owner, or tags across many customers at once:
- Open the Customers list.
- Filter to the set you want to change. Use the Workbench filters and views if the filter is one you’ll reuse.
- Tick the header checkbox to select the visible page, or Select all matching for the full filter.
- Click Edit selected in the toolbar. Pick the field, set the value, hit Apply.
The audit log records one entry per customer, not one per bulk action, so you can track who touched which record.
The gotcha: locked fields from CRM sync
If a field has a sync icon, your field mapping is overwriting it on every sync. Edit it in Pivotal and the CRM will stomp the value on its next run. Either fix it upstream in HubSpot or Stripe, or change the mapping for that field from Sync to Sync once.
